Hedda Ødegaard (born 7 January 1995) is a Norwegian tennis player.
She won the Norway National Tennis Championships in 2011 both singles and doubles.
[1] Ødegaard made her Fed Cup debut for Norway in 2010, while the team was competing in the Europe/Africa Zone Group II, when she was 15 years and 113 days old.
